Pumpkin Spice Rice Pudding

Ingredients:

1 1/2 c. rice (cooked)
2 c. milk (divided)
1/3 c. sugar
1/4 tsp salt
1 egg
1/2 c. pumpkin
1/2 tsp pumpkin pie spice
1 Tbs butter
1 tsp pumpkin spice extract (or vanilla)

Directions:

In a saucepan over medium heat, combine rice, sugar, salt, and 1 1/2 cups of the milk. Cook 15-20 minutes or until thick and creamy. Beat the egg in the measuring cup with the remaining 1/2 cup milk and add to the saucepan, cook an additional 2 minutes, stirring constantly.  Add pumpkin and spices.  Stir until completely combined.

Remove from heat and stir in butter and extract.
